Description : What were the contributions of Lala Lajpat Rai in National Movement? -SST 10th

Last Answer : Lala Lajpat Rai (1865-1928) known as Sher-i-Punjab (Lion of Punjab) was a fearless leader. Born in 1865 he joined the Congress in 1888. When there was a split in the Congress in 1907, he joined ... said, Lathi blows inflicted on me would prove one day as nails in the coffin of the British Empire.

Description : Which of these straits separates Asia from Africa? (1) Malacca (2) Hormuz (3) Bab-al-Mandeb (4) Bosphorus

Last Answer : (3) Bab-al-Mandeb Explanation: Bab-el-Mandeb separates Asia from Africa at Aden. It is located between Yemen on the Arabian Peninsula, and Djibouti and Eritrea in the Horn of Africa. Precisely ... Yemen from Djibouti and Eritrea and connects Red sea with Gulf of Aden (part of Arabian sea).

Description : The “Dark Continent” is - (1) Africa (2) South America (3) Australia (4) Asia

Last Answer : (1) Africa Explanation: Dark Continent is a former name for Africa. It is so used because its hinterland was largely unknown and therefore mysterious to Europeans until the 19th century. Henry M. Stanley was probably the first to use the term in his 1878 account Through the Dark Continent.

Description : The Continent through which the imaginary lines of Tropic of Cancer, Tropic of Carpricorn and Equator pass, is - (1) Africa (2) Australia (3) Europe (4) Asia

Last Answer : (1) Africa Explanation: Africa is the only continent through which all the main latitude lines; Equator, Tropic of Cancer and Tropic of Capricorn, pass. The Prime Meridian (a line of longitude) also passes through Africa.
